The Rise of Electric Scooters
Electric scooters, typically referred to as e-scooters, have rapidly become a typical sight in cities around the world. These compact, battery-powered vehicles supply a quick and simple method to travel short distances, making them perfect for city environments. The surge in appeal can be credited to a number of factors:
Convenience: E-scooters are easy to use and can be rented or acquired for individual usage. They need very little upkeep and can be kept in small spaces, making them a useful option for city residents.Cost-Effectiveness: Compared to cars and trucks, e-scooters are significantly cheaper to buy and operate. They need no fuel, and the expense of charging is very little.Environmental Benefits: E-scooters produce zero emissions, making them an environmentally friendly option to gasoline-powered cars. The market for scooter mobility varies and rapidly broadening. Business are not just producing and offering e-scooters however also offering rental services through mobile apps. This has actually created a multi-faceted market with numerous players and service models:
Manufacturers: Companies like Segway, Bird, and Lime are blazing a trail in e-scooter production. They produce a large variety of designs, from standard commuter scooters to high-performance designs for lovers.Rental Services: Ride-sharing companies have incorporated e-scooters into their platforms, permitting users to rent scooters on-demand. Popular apps like Bird, Lime, and Spin have actually made it easy for people to gain access to e-scooters without the requirement for ownership.Merchants: Brick-and-mortar and online sellers are likewise capitalizing on the growing need for e-scooters. Q: Are e-scooters safe to ride?A: E-scooters can be safe if riders follow traffic rules, use protective equipment, and keep their scooters. However, it's essential to be aware of potential dangers and ride defensively.

Q: How much does it cost to buy an e-scooter?A: The expense of an e-scooter can differ widely depending on the brand name and model. Basic models can start around ₤ 200, while high-performance scooters can cost over ₤ 1,000.

Q: Can I ride an e-scooter on the pathway?A: Regulations vary by city, however lots of places allow e-scooters on sidewalks as long as riders yield to pedestrians and follow posted speed limits.

Q: How long do e-scooter batteries last?A: Battery life can differ, but a lot of e-scooters can travel between 15 to 30 miles on a single charge, depending on the model and use.

Q: Are e-scooters suitable for all ages?A: E-scooters are generally appropriate for individuals aged 16 and older. However, some models are created for younger users, and adult guidance is recommended for more youthful riders.
